Chemistry Check For Cougars: Beyond Attraction

Start with curiosity but move toward clarity. Shared physical attraction is important, but long-term satisfaction in cougar relationships often comes from alignment on values, life stage, and expectations. Use gentle conversations to test real fit rather than assuming goals match because of initial chemistry.

Talk About Life Rhythm And Priorities

Discuss daily routines, work commitments, social life, and how much free time each person wants together. Ask questions like:

  • How do you usually spend your weekends?
  • How much independence or together-time feels healthy to you?
  • Are travel or relocation on your radar soon?

Shared rhythm reduces friction when lifestyles differ.

Clarify Relationship Goals

Be direct but respectful about what you both want. People in this category can have diverse aims—casual dating, mentorship-style relationships, long-term partnership, or something else. Useful questions:

  • What does a successful relationship look like to you right now?
  • Are you open to exclusivity, or do you prefer something more flexible?
  • How do you see this fitting into your life over the next year?

Explore Values And Boundaries

Values—about honesty, family, finances, and how you handle public attention—shape how you connect. Share limits and expectations early so neither person feels surprised later. Try prompts like:

  • How do you like to handle disagreements?
  • Are there topics or behaviors that feel off-limits?
  • How do you want to handle introductions to friends or family?

Check Communication Style

Notice how you each talk about feelings, plans, and conflict. Do you prefer face-to-face talks, texts, or scheduled check-ins? A short compatibility test: describe a small problem (a missed date, miscommunication) and listen for tone—accountability, defensiveness, or curiosity. That tells you how resilient your communication might be.

Ask Thoughtful, Safe Questions

Keep early questions respectful and noninvasive. Examples that surface alignment without pressure:

  • What energizes you right now?
  • What kind of support do you appreciate from a partner?
  • How do you balance independence and connection?

Take Small Steps And Reassess

Try low-stakes activities together to test compatibility—dinner, a shared hobby, or a weekend outing. After a few interactions, check in: what felt good, what felt awkward, and would adjustments help? Regular, honest reassessment keeps both people informed and respected.

Above all, prioritize consent, clear expectations, and mutual respect. Those foundations help chemistry grow into something steady—or help you recognize quickly when it’s not the right fit.

Dating Confidence Reset

Start by clarifying what you actually want. Take five minutes to write down your top three priorities for dating right now—whether it’s casual conversation, meeting new people, practicing flirting, or finding something long-term. When you know your intention, it’s easier to say yes to the right conversations and no to the rest.

Pace conversations with purpose. Use short check-ins to move from messages to a phone call or video chat when you feel a basic connection. Aim for steady steps—chat, ask a few meaningful questions, suggest a low-pressure call—rather than endless messaging. That keeps momentum without rushing or over-investing emotionally.

Keep expectations realistic. Most interactions won’t lead to a long-term match, and that’s normal. Treat each conversation as practice in reading signals, refining what you want, and learning how to communicate. Celebrate small wins: a thoughtful reply, a fun chat, or a clear boundary honored.

Notice progress, not just outcomes. Track simple, kind metrics for yourself: did you try a new opener this week, set a boundary, or suggest an in-person meet-up? These signs of growth build steady confidence more than counting matches or replies.

Choose matches with intention. Scan profiles for a few clear compatibility cues—shared interests, similar communication style, or goals that don’t contradict yours. When you prioritize quality over quantity, you’ll spend time with people who are more likely to respect your pace and values.

Protect your emotional energy. Set limits on how much time you’ll spend swiping or messaging each day. Take regular breaks when dating feels draining: a short pause can prevent burnout and help you return more present and selective.
